The bachelor's program at UVM was ranked #110 on College Factual's Best Schools for dance list. It is also ranked #1 in Vermont.
During the 2020-2021 academic year, University of Vermont handed out 6 bachelor's degrees in dance.
Take a look at the following statistics related to the make-up of the dance majors at University of Vermont.
All of the 6 students who graduated with a Bachelor’s in dance from UVM in 2021 were women.
The majority of bachelor's degree recipients in this major at UVM are white. In the most recent graduating class for which data is available, 83% of students f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from University of Vermont with a bachelor's in dance.
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
---|---|
Asian | 1 |
Black or African American | 0 |
Hispanic or Latino | 0 |
White | 5 |
Non-Resident Aliens | 0 |
Other Races | 0 |
